GOSPELNATION RECORDS DYNAMIC NEW GROUP "EXPRESSION OF PRAISE" RECEIVES THE PRESTIGIOUS JUNO AWARD NOMINATION FOR BEST GOSPEL ALBUM.

Toronto, Canada - On Wednesday January 27th, Canadian Academy of Recording Arts and Sciences (CARAS) officially announced the 1999 JUNO Award nominees for this years Best Gospel Album, among the groups mentioned was Markham, Ont. based community youth choir "Expression of Praise" for their debut release of "To Whom It May Concern".

"To Whom it May Concern's" project producer Terry Henry is the first to admit that there were many trials in the making of their first album. He says that with each individual challenge that blocked their route towards the making of the album consistently they were overcome by God's divine intervention. And always just on time. The 21-year old says that the completion of the album marks the end of a long journey that started as a dream at 16. As a matter of fact all the songs on the album were written before Henry graduated from high school.

As the title suggests, "To Whom It May Concern" is designed to be interpreted as a letter to their audience as written by the entire group.

Henry says their message of God's goodness concerns everyone. The album features a range of musical styles. Powerful Worship and Praise songs, well executed Jazz oriented ballads, with energizing soul and blues combinations are complemented by dynamic Christian Contemporary tunes. The album is a testimony to this young man's versatility and musical maturity.
